• word of the day

    centaurium calycosum

    centaurium calycosum - Dictionary definition and meaning for word centaurium calycosum

    Definition
    (noun) erect plant with small clusters of pink trumpet-shaped flowers of southwestern United States
    Synonyms : rosita
Download our Mobile App Today
Receive our word of the day
on Whatsapp